Blood Test Results in Cats with Diabetes – What to Expect


Why Are Blood Tests Important for Cats with Diabetes?

Veterinary care for a cat

Blood tests are crucial for managing diabetes in cats because they provide essential information about blood glucose levels and overall metabolic health. Glucose (71-182 mg/dL) is a key marker, reflecting the immediate concentration of sugar in the bloodstream. A value above the reference range indicates hyperglycemia, which can be associated with uncontrolled diabetes or other stressors like infection or inflammation. Fructosamine (219-365 µmol/L), another important parameter, measures glycemic control over a longer period—typically 2 to 3 weeks. Elevated fructosamine levels suggest poor glucose regulation and may indicate that the treatment plan needs revisiting by your veterinarian. Both markers should be interpreted alongside other clinical findings such as body condition score, water intake, and urinary glucose. For instance, if a cat with diabetes has an elevated body condition score along with high blood glucose levels, it might suggest that the diet or the treatment plan needs revisiting; those decisions belong to your veterinarian. Abnormal results on these tests often prompt further investigation into underlying causes of hyperglycemia, including stress-induced hyperglycaemia, concurrent illness, or treatment that is no longer matched to the cat. Comprehensive blood work also helps monitor for complications like ketoacidosis, which can be life-threatening if not addressed promptly. Early detection through regular testing allows for timely intervention and better management of diabetes in cats. Veterinarians may consider additional tests such as serum ketones (β-hydroxybutyrate) to assess metabolic status or urinalysis to check for glucose and ketone presence, further refining the diagnosis and treatment plan. Regular monitoring ensures that diabetic cats receive optimal care tailored to their specific needs. For example, if a cat’s blood test results show consistently high levels of serum ketones, it could indicate that the body is breaking down fat for energy because the body cannot use glucose for energy, which leads to ketoacidosis. This condition requires immediate medical attention and possibly hospitalization. In summary, regular blood tests are vital in managing diabetes in cats as they help track glucose levels, monitor long-term glycemic control, identify potential complications early on, and guide necessary adjustments in treatment plans.

What Is Glucose and Why Does It Matter in Diabetic Cats?

Glucose is a simple sugar that serves as the primary energy source for cells throughout the body. In diabetic cats, glucose regulation becomes impaired due to either insufficient insulin production or reduced sensitivity to insulin, leading to elevated blood glucose levels. The normal reference range for glucose in cats is 71-182 mg/dL.

High glucose levels (hyperglycemia) indicate that a cat’s body is not effectively using or producing enough insulin to regulate blood sugar properly. This can lead to various clinical signs such as increased thirst, frequent urination, weight loss despite an appetite, and lethargy. Persistent hyperglycemia without proper management can result in more severe complications like diabetic ketoacidosis (DKA), which is a medical emergency.

Glucose levels should be interpreted alongside other markers such as fructosamine, which reflects average blood glucose control over the past two to three weeks. Additionally, monitoring for ketones and electrolyte imbalances can provide further insight into the metabolic status of diabetic cats. For instance, if a cat is experiencing persistent hyperglycemia despite dietary adjustments and insulin therapy, these additional tests may help identify underlying issues that need addressing.

  • Fructosamine: This test measures glycated proteins in the bloodstream, providing an indication of long-term blood glucose control. Elevated fructosamine levels suggest poor regulation of blood sugar over time and can guide adjustments to treatment plans.
  • Ketone Levels: Elevated ketones suggest that the body is breaking down fat for energy due to insufficient insulin availability. This condition, known as ketosis, can be a precursor to DKA if left untreated.

Veterinarians may consider further tests such as a complete blood count (CBC) and serum biochemistry panel to assess overall health status, particularly in cases where hyperglycemia persists despite treatment adjustments. These additional tests help rule out other conditions that might complicate diabetes management or contribute to poor glucose control.

Treatment typically involves dietary management, regular glucose monitoring, and administration of insulin under veterinary guidance. Dietary changes often include reducing carbohydrates and increasing fiber content in the diet to stabilize blood sugar levels more effectively. Regular monitoring is crucial for adjusting insulin doses appropriately and ensuring that the cat remains healthy without experiencing hypoglycemia.

What Can Cause Abnormal Glucose Levels in Diabetic Cats?

In diabetic cats, abnormal glucose levels can indicate several underlying issues that require veterinary attention. Elevated blood glucose (hyperglycemia) is a hallmark of diabetes mellitus and may also occur due to stress or other metabolic disorders such as hyperthyroidism, feline hyperthyroidism or Cushing’s disease. Conversely, low blood glucose (hypoglycemia) can be dangerous and typically indicates an imbalance in insulin therapy, often resulting from excessive insulin administration or missed meals.

Glucose levels are closely monitored in diabetic cats because they reflect the effectiveness of treatment and overall health status. A value above the normal reference range—especially alongside fructosamine—points toward poor glycemic control or potential complications such as ketoacidosis, warranting immediate veterinary evaluation. For instance, persistent hyperglycemia can lead to chronic complications like cataracts, urinary tract infections, and neuropathy.

  • Diabetes Mellitus: Chronic hyperglycemia due to insulin deficiency or resistance. This condition is characterized by high blood glucose levels that persist over time despite treatment adjustments.
  • Ketoacidosis: Severe metabolic disturbance characterized by high blood glucose and ketones, often resulting from inadequate insulin therapy or other stressors like infection or dehydration.
  • Hypoglycemia: Potentially life-threatening condition where blood glucose levels drop too low, often due to excessive insulin administration. This can occur if the cat misses a meal or receives more of its medication than the current plan calls for.

The veterinarian may then prescribe appropriate treatment such as adjusting insulin dosage or providing intravenous fluids to stabilize the cat’s metabolic status. The exact dose and method are determined by the attending veterinarian based on individual assessment, taking into account factors like the cat’s weight, activity level, and overall health condition.

How Does Blood Sugar Compare with Other Diabetes Markers?

Portrait of a cat at a veterinary clinic
Blood sugar, measured as glucose in a cat’s blood sample, is a critical marker for diagnosing and monitoring diabetes mellitus.

Elevated glucose levels indicate impaired insulin function or resistance, leading to hyperglycemia. In cats, high glucose can be associated with genetic predispositions such as those seen in Burmese cats. Blood glucose testing provides immediate information about the cat’s current blood sugar status, which is crucial for acute management decisions.

Fructosamine is another important marker used alongside blood glucose to assess long-term glycemic control over the past two to three weeks. It reflects the average blood sugar levels and provides a more comprehensive picture of diabetes management than a single glucose measurement can offer. Fructosamine testing helps veterinarians adjust insulin therapy and dietary interventions for better regulation, ensuring that the cat’s overall health is maintained over time.

When evaluating diabetes in cats, it is essential to consider other markers such as ketones and glycosuria. Ketone bodies indicate the breakdown of fat for energy due to insufficient glucose utilization, which can be dangerous if not managed promptly. Elevated ketone levels may suggest that the cat’s body is switching from using glucose to burning fat for energy, a condition known as diabetic ketoacidosis (DKA), which requires immediate medical intervention.

Glycosuria, or the presence of sugar in urine, confirms that blood glucose levels have exceeded renal threshold (approximately the reference range), indicating uncontrolled diabetes. This marker is particularly useful for monitoring cats with suspected hyperglycemia but normal blood glucose readings due to stress-induced hyperglycemia or other factors.

Marker Normal Range What It Adds
Glucose 71-182 mg/dL Indicates immediate blood sugar levels and acute hyperglycemia.
Fructosamine 219-365 µmol/L Reflects long-term glycemic control over 2-3 weeks.
Ketones Laboratory-specific Indicates fat metabolism and potential ketoacidosis.
Glycosuria Laboratory-specific Confirms uncontrolled diabetes when blood glucose exceeds renal threshold.
